Comprehending Window Condensation

Before resolving repair options, it's important to understand what causes window condensation. The primary aspects adding to window condensation consist of:

  • Temperature Differences: Warm air holds more moisture than cold air. As a result, when warm, damp air enters contact with cold surface areas, such as windows, condensation takes place.
  • Humidity Levels: High indoor humidity can result in excess moisture in the air, resulting in condensation on windows, specifically in winter season.
  • Poor Insulation: Insufficient or broken insulation can cause windows to end up being exceedingly cold, increasing the probability of condensation.

Repairing Window Condensation

The technique to repairing window condensation can vary based upon the root cause and the level of the problem. Below are some effective repair and mitigation methods:

1. Improve Ventilation

Enhancing air flow can significantly lower humidity levels in your home.

  • Use Exhaust Fans: Ensure that bathroom and kitchen exhaust fans are working correctly. They assist expel moist air outdoors.
  • Install a Dehumidifier: In high-humidity locations, a dehumidifier can efficiently remove moisture from the air.
  • Open Windows: Occasionally opening windows can assist stabilize indoor and outside humidity levels.

2. Update Insulation

Improving the insulation around windows can keep the glass warmer and decrease the opportunities of condensation.

  • Install Insulating Window Film: This transparent movie assists keep the warm air inside while reflecting cold air outside.
  • Use Storm Windows: Adding storm windows can develop an additional layer of insulation.
  • Enhance Wall Insulation: Consider assessing and updating the insulation in your walls for included security versus temperature level fluctuations.

3. Window Replacement

In specific cases, window replacement might be the most efficient option, especially if the windows are single-pane or old.

  • Double or Triple-Pane Windows: These windows include gas fills (like argon or krypton) between the panes, enhancing insulation.
  • Low-E Glass Windows: Low-emissivity (Low-E) glass shows heat, assisting to keep a more consistent indoor temperature level.

Preventative Measures to Avoid Future Condensation

Taking actions to prevent window condensation can save homeowners from expensive repairs and health concerns connected with mold.

Preventative Strategies

  • Routine Maintenance: Perform routine examinations of windows and seal any leaks.
  • Monitor Indoor Humidity: Use a hygrometer to keep an eye on indoor humidity levels, going for a balance between 30-50%.
  • Environment Control: Use heating and cooling systems to preserve a stable indoor temperature year-round.

Regularly Asked Questions (FAQ)

Q1: Why does my window sweat during winter?

A1: Window sweating generally occurs in winter season due to warm, humid air inside your home entering contact with the cold glass. This temperature difference causes condensation.

Q2: How can I tell if my window is correctly insulated?

Q3: Is window condensation an indication of a severe problem?

A3: Not necessarily. While condensation can indicate high humidity or poor insulation, it does not constantly signal a severe problem. Nevertheless, relentless condensation can result in mold development and deterioration of window frames.

Q4: Can I fix window condensation myself?

A4: Many house owners can address minor condensation problems by improving ventilation and insulation. However, extensive repairs or replacements may require professional help.

Q5: Is it worth investing in brand-new windows to fix condensation issues?

A5: If your current windows are old or single-pane, investing in energy-efficient windows can fix condensation problems and lower cooling and heating expenses in the long run.
